Siddharth Gupta

Siddharth Gupta Email and Phone Number

Actively Looking For Java Developer role @ Austin, TX, US
Austin, TX, US
Siddharth Gupta's Location
Austin, Texas, United States, United States
About Siddharth Gupta

● 2+ years of software development experience in object-oriented programming, design and development of Multi - Tier distributed, Enterprise applications using Java and J2EE technologies with Software Development Life Cycle.● Good experience of Software Development Life Cycle (SDLC) methodologies like Agile.● Expertise in Core Java with strong understanding and working knowledge in Object Oriented Concepts, Collections, Multithreading, Data Structures, Algorithms, Exception Handling and Polymorphism.● JavaBeans, Java, JDBC, JUnit, HTML.● Experience of test-driven development and unit testing.● Good work experience in writing SQL queries with major Relational Databases.● Good knowledge in MS office (MS Excel, MS Word).● Hands on experience in Stored Procedures, Functions, Triggers and strong experience in writing queries, using SQL Server and MySQL.● Good knowledge of version control tools such as Git.● Experience of working under time constraint with consistency and reliability.● Experience in developing data applications in Linux/Windows environments.● Excellent communicative, interpersonal, intuitive, analysis, leadership skills, quick starter with ability to master and apply new concepts.● Excellent analytical, written and verbal communication skills and ability to effectively communicate with all levels of management and staff.

Siddharth Gupta's Current Company Details
Epsilon

Epsilon

Actively Looking For Java Developer role
Austin, TX, US
Siddharth Gupta Work Experience Details
  • Epsilon
    Epsilon
    Austin, Tx, Us
  • Epsilon
    Java Developer
    Epsilon Mar 2022 - Present
    ● Implemented and followed Agile development methodology within the cross functional team and acted as a bridge between the business user group and the technical team.● Review basic SQL queries and developed SQL Queries for ORACLE database to perform backend database testing.● Used Spring for REST APIs, Spring Boot for micro-services and Spring Batch for running batch jobs● Participate in walkthroughs of requirements, specifications, database designs and test strategies.● Extensively Worked on Quality center for Test Data Management, preparing Test suite for the Release and defect tracking.● All the functionality is implemented using Spring Boot and Hibernate ORM. Implemented Java EE components using Spring MVC, Spring IOC, Spring transactions and Spring security modules.● Manage Departmental Reporting systems, troubleshooting daily issues, and integrating existing Access databases with numerous external data source including (SQL, Excel, &Access). ● Implemented on Agile Process.● Worked in providing solutions for deployed Java products.● Implemented Data Access Layer (DAL) using Spring Data and Hibernate ORM tool.● Involved in injecting dependencies into code using Spring IOC module of Spring Framework.● Used Git for version control.● Created connections to database using Hibernate session Factory, using Hibernate APIs to retrieve and store data to the database with Hibernate transaction control.● Used Log4J components for logging.● Perform daily monitoring of log files and resolve issues.
  • Dell Technologies
    Java Developer
    Dell Technologies Jan 2019 - Dec 2020
    ● Analyzed the specifications provided by the clients.● Generated the test reports and documented the defects and issues.● Provided technical guidance to business analysts, gathered the requirements and converted them into technical specifications/artifacts.● Write tests for existing and created code to ensure compatibility and stability.● Designed and developed Customer registration and login screens using JSP, HTML, CSS and JavaScript.● Developed web pages to display the account transactions and details pertaining to that account using JSP, HTML, Spring and CSS.● Involved in unit testing using JUnit and system testing and responsible for preparing test scripts for the system testing.● Used Spring Boot Actuator to monitor and manage the application in production environment● Generated comprehensive analytical reports by running SQL queries against current databases to conduct data analysis.● Performed Functionality Testing, Security Testing, Compatibility Testing and User Acceptance Testing manually.● Created tickets for defects and bugs and assigning to appropriate developer group.● Analyzed the specifications provided by the clients.● Generated the test reports and documented the defects and issues.● Implemented on Agile Process.● Implemented Data Access Layer (DAL) using Spring Data and Hibernate ORM tool● Worked in providing solutions for deployed Java product.● Performed the backend database testing to ensure the values generated are correct.● Involved in unit testing using JUnit and system testing and responsible for preparing test scripts for the system testing.● All the functionality is implemented using Spring Boot and Hibernate ORM. Implemented Java EE components using Spring MVC, Spring IOC, Spring transactions and Spring security modules● Development of user-friendly interface using front end technologies like HTML, CSS, bootstrap.● Developed the main functionalities/operations of the database application using queries, triggers etc

Siddharth Gupta Education Details

  • University Of Florida
    University Of Florida
    Computer Science

Frequently Asked Questions about Siddharth Gupta

What company does Siddharth Gupta work for?

Siddharth Gupta works for Epsilon

What is Siddharth Gupta's role at the current company?

Siddharth Gupta's current role is Actively Looking For Java Developer role.

What schools did Siddharth Gupta attend?

Siddharth Gupta attended University Of Florida.

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Aero Online

Your AI prospecting assistant

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.